Understanding the Sacrum’s Role in the Body
The sacrum is a large, triangular bone located at the base of the spine, nestled between the two hip bones. It forms the back part of the pelvis and plays a crucial role in supporting the upper body’s weight when standing or sitting. This bone is composed of five fused vertebrae, which provide strength and stability to the pelvic region.
Because it acts as a keystone connecting the spine to the pelvis, any injury to the sacrum can have significant effects on mobility and overall body mechanics. Despite its sturdy construction, it is not immune to fractures. The question arises: Can you break your sacrum? The answer is yes, but such injuries are uncommon compared to other spinal fractures.
How Sacral Fractures Occur
Sacral fractures typically happen due to severe trauma or stress overload. High-impact events like car accidents, falls from heights, or crushing injuries can cause a break in this bone. In older adults, especially those with osteoporosis or other bone-weakening conditions, even minor falls can lead to sacral fractures.
There are different types of sacral fractures depending on how and where the bone breaks:
- Transverse fractures: These run horizontally across the sacrum.
- Vertical fractures: These run vertically along one side.
- Comminuted fractures: The bone breaks into several pieces.
The severity of these fractures varies widely. Some may be stable and heal with conservative treatment, while others might require surgical intervention.
Risk Factors for Sacral Fractures
Certain factors increase the likelihood of breaking your sacrum:
- Osteoporosis: Weakens bones, making them more prone to fracture.
- Age: Older adults have higher risk due to decreased bone density.
- High-impact trauma: Car crashes or falls from significant heights.
- Cancer metastasis: Tumors weakening bone structure.
Understanding these risks helps in both prevention and early diagnosis when symptoms arise.
Symptoms Indicating a Possible Sacral Fracture
Recognizing a sacral fracture isn’t always straightforward because symptoms can be subtle or mimic other conditions like lower back pain or sciatica. However, certain signs strongly suggest injury:
- Pain in lower back or buttocks: Often sharp and worsens with movement.
- Difficulties sitting or standing: Discomfort increases when putting pressure on pelvis.
- Numbness or tingling: In rare cases, nerve involvement causes sensations down legs.
- Bowel or bladder dysfunction: Indicates possible nerve damage needing urgent care.
If you experience persistent pain after trauma or notice neurological symptoms, seeking medical evaluation is critical.
The Diagnostic Process for Sacral Fractures
Doctors use several tools to confirm if you’ve broken your sacrum:
- X-rays: Initial imaging but may miss subtle fractures due to complex anatomy.
- CT scans: Provide detailed cross-sectional images revealing fracture patterns clearly.
- MRI scans: Useful for detecting soft tissue injury and nerve involvement.
Prompt diagnosis ensures appropriate treatment plans are put in place swiftly.
Treatment Options for Sacral Fractures
Treatment depends on fracture type, stability, and symptoms. Most sacral fractures heal well with conservative management:
- Pain control: NSAIDs and sometimes short-term opioids help manage discomfort.
- Activity modification: Avoiding heavy lifting and limiting movement that aggravates pain.
- Physical therapy: Strengthening pelvic muscles aids recovery once initial pain subsides.
Surgery becomes necessary if fractures are unstable or involve nerve compression. Procedures may include internal fixation with screws or plates to stabilize bones.
Surgical vs. Non-Surgical Outcomes
Non-surgical treatment often leads to full recovery within weeks to months for stable fractures. Surgery carries risks but provides relief when structural integrity is compromised. Rehabilitation focuses on restoring mobility while preventing complications like blood clots or muscle atrophy.
The Impact of Sacral Fractures on Daily Life
A broken sacrum affects more than just physical health; it influences daily activities profoundly. Sitting becomes uncomfortable; walking might be painful; even sleeping positions require adjustment. This disruption can lead to frustration and emotional stress.
However, with proper care, most people regain their prior function without long-term disability. Early intervention minimizes complications such as chronic pain syndromes or nerve damage that could impair bowel and bladder control.
Lifestyle Adjustments During Recovery
During healing:
- Avoid prolonged sitting—use cushions designed for pelvic support.
- Tilt body weight evenly when standing to reduce pressure on injured areas.
- Avoid high-impact activities until cleared by healthcare providers.
These changes help protect healing tissues while maintaining overall fitness levels through low-impact exercises like swimming or stationary cycling.

The Importance of Bone Health in Preventing Sacral Fractures
Maintaining strong bones reduces fracture risks dramatically. Calcium-rich diets combined with vitamin D support bone density. Weight-bearing exercises stimulate bone remodeling processes that keep bones robust over time.
Avoiding smoking and excessive alcohol consumption also plays a vital role since both weaken skeletal strength. Regular screenings for osteoporosis allow early intervention before any fracture occurs.
Nutritional Tips for Strong Bones
- Dairy products like milk, cheese, yogurt provide abundant calcium sources.
- Dietary supplements may be necessary if intake is insufficient through food alone.
- Sufficient sunlight exposure helps vitamin D synthesis crucial for calcium absorption.
- A balanced diet rich in fruits and vegetables supports overall skeletal health through antioxidants and minerals like magnesium and potassium.
These lifestyle choices form a powerful defense against fragility fractures including those affecting the sacrum.
The Recovery Journey After Breaking Your Sacrum: What To Expect?
Healing from a sacral fracture demands patience and adherence to medical advice. Pain peaks during initial days but gradually diminishes with rest and medication. Physical therapy usually starts once acute symptoms subside—this phase focuses on regaining flexibility, strength, and balance.
Psychological resilience matters too; coping with temporary limitations requires support from family, friends, or professionals if needed.
Long-term follow-up ensures no complications arise such as malunion (improper healing) which could cause chronic discomfort or mobility issues.
Pain Management Strategies During Recovery
Besides medications prescribed by doctors:
- Icing inflamed areas reduces swelling during early stages.
- Mild stretching exercises prevent stiffness without stressing injury site.
- Mental relaxation techniques like meditation help manage chronic discomfort perception effectively.
Combining these approaches accelerates recovery while improving overall well-being during this challenging period.
